- Q: What material is the spark plug wire lead made of? A: The spark plug wire lead is made of silicone. This high-performance material provides excellent insulation and durability for marine applications.
- Q: What is the length of the PARTSRUN spark plug wire lead? A: The spark plug wire lead is nine inches long. This length is specifically designed for optimal fit in Mercury and Mariner outboard engines.
- Q: Is this spark plug wire lead suitable for all outboard engines? A: No, this spark plug wire lead is specifically designed for Mercury and Mariner outboard engines. It replaces part numbers Mercury eighty-four dash eight hundred thirteen thousand seven hundred fifteen A one and ZF six hundred ninety-six.
